Propaganda is an album[1]. Propaganda ranks in the top 2% of album ent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(52 views/month).[2]
Key Facts
- Propaganda's instance of is recorded as album[3].
- Propaganda's genre is post-punk[4].
- Propaganda was performed by The Sound[5].
- Propaganda is part of The Sound's albums in chronological order[6].
- Propaganda was published on April 26, 1999[7].
- Propaganda's title is recorded as Propaganda[8].
- Propaganda's form of creative work is recorded as studio album[9].
